Poster of Cast and Crew in Urban Horror - The Last Bus (Season 1 - Episode 3) - The Last Bus

Urban Horror - Season 1 - The Last Bus (Episode 3)

Episode Aired On:
Friday, July 12 2024
Released within the last year
External Links
Instagram logo